VANCOUVER – Vicinity Motor Corp. (NASDAQ:VEV)(TSXV:VMC), a supplier of commercial electric vehicles in North America, announced today that it has received a new purchase order from the Corporation of the Town of Orangeville, Ontario, for two Vicinity™ Classic buses. These buses are scheduled for delivery in 2025 and will be servicing the town's three active transit routes.

The purchase is part of Orangeville's efforts to enhance its public transportation system. With a population of approximately 30,000, the suburb is looking to provide efficient and value-driven transit solutions for its residents.

Vicinity Motor Corp.'s President, Brent Phillips, commented on the deal, emphasizing the company's strong brand recognition and the role of the Vicinity Classic buses in its revenue strategy. He noted that the buses' lower upfront and operational costs make them an attractive option for communities seeking economical transit solutions.

Phillips also indicated that each new order presents an opportunity to discuss the expansion of fleets or a transition to electric models, like the Vicinity Lightning electric transit bus and the VMC 1200 Class 3 electric truck. Vicinity Motor Corp. is poised to continue collaborating with Orangeville in anticipation of the early delivery next year.

Vicinity Motor Corp. operates through a dealer network and partnerships with manufacturing entities to provide a range of vehicles, including electric, CNG, and clean-diesel buses, as well as electric trucks to the transit and industrial markets.

In other recent news, Vicinity Motor Corp. has been making significant strides in the commercial electric vehicle sector. The company reported a substantial 400% revenue surge in Q1 2024, driven by the delivery of 44 VMC 1200 electric trucks and 22 Vicinity Classic clean diesel buses, despite a net loss of $3.7 million.

Moreover, Vicinity Motor Corp. recently appointed Jeff Madura as Senior Director of Sales, a move expected to bolster the company's sales efforts in the growing electric vehicle market. Madura, with his extensive experience in the commercial vehicle industry, is anticipated to enhance Vicinity's market position.

In product news, the company's VMC 1200 all-electric truck has successfully met all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standards, allowing it to be legally sold in the United States. This certification, coupled with the completion of U.S. Environmental Protection Agency Vehicle Certification and Compliance Testing, opens up new market opportunities for Vicinity across the United States.

Furthermore, Vicinity exhibited its VMC 1200 Class 3 Electric Truck at the Advanced Clean Transportation Expo, marking the company's third consecutive year at the event. This exposure is expected to expand the company's presence in the U.S. market.

These are recent developments that highlight Vicinity Motor Corp.'s ongoing efforts to strengthen its position in the commercial electric vehicle sector.

As Vicinity Motor Corp. (NASDAQ:VEV) (TSXV:VMC) secures a new order for its Vicinity Classic buses, the financial landscape of the company provides a nuanced picture of its market position. With a market capitalization of $28.93 million, the company reflects a relatively small player in the industry.

Despite a notable revenue growth of 65.18% in the last twelve months as of Q1 2024, VEV's financial health is challenged by a significant debt burden and weak gross profit margins of just 11.97%. These figures, coupled with a high price volatility in its stock trading, underscore the risks associated with investing in the company.

One of the InvestingPro Tips highlights that the company's short term obligations exceed its liquid assets, which raises concerns about its liquidity and ability to meet immediate financial obligations. Moreover, analysts do not expect Vicinity Motor Corp. to be profitable this year, with a negative P/E Ratio of -1.65, suggesting that investors are wary of the company's earning potential in the near term. The stock's recent performance has been underwhelming, trading near its 52-week low and experiencing a one-month price total return of -14.49%.
